**Q: How does the Brindlewood partner SFTP drop work?**

Partners at Ostermark Logistics upload nightly manifests to a dedicated SFTP endpoint managed by our Relay team. Accounts are key-only, chrooted per partner, and rotated quarterly. Files are scanned, checksummed, and moved to an internal bucket within five minutes; nothing persists on the drop host beyond one hour. Audit logs ship to Lanternview for retention. The full access-control matrix and rotation schedule are maintained on the internal page below.

wiki page, bagaf-fawip: https://harbor.tolvaqsys.local/pages/repo/pages/secrets/eac969ffc71f356b

**Q: How do assistants get into the hardware lab?**

The lab on Level 2 is badge-restricted, so your standard pass won't open it. If you're dropping off kit or escorting a vendor, you can use the assistant access code instead — just log your visit in the binder by the door. Here's the code:

door code, yagap-bahof: bdg-O-05

### Re-running the contrast audit

If Paletteer flags a regression, re-run the scan with `audit --contrast` against staging first — prod scans are slow and noisy. Results land in the Huebird dashboard within a few minutes. The scanner talks to our internal theme-token service, so you'll need its key, which is pasted below for convenience.

gateway credential: kto23_dolYgAScEh2TaPOlStqOl98

- [ ] **Step 7: Breaker override escrow.** After sealing the signing keys for the Tallgrove upstream API circuit breaker, confirm the support team can force the breaker open during a full outage. The override bundle lives in the sealed escrow drawer and is useless without its unlock phrase. Two ceremony witnesses must initial this step before proceeding. The escrow bundle is decrypted with the recovery passphrase that follows.

vault phrase of kahip-kahop = holath-quenmir